Directions:

  1. Preheat oven to 375.
  2. Lightly spread butter over bread and toast in oven; bread should have color, but still be soft. (Less than 10 minutes).
  3. Remove from oven and sprinkle slices with goat cheese crumbles; return to oven for about 3 minutes, until goat cheese is softened enough to spread.
  4. Remove from oven and spread out crumbles over toast; sprinkle with walnuts and drizzle with honey and a grind of black pepper over toasts!
